The TC1300Y-2.7VUATR is a low dropout linear regulator that operates by comparing the input voltage (VIN) with a reference voltage. It adjusts the output voltage (VOUT) to maintain a stable value, compensating for changes in load and input voltage. The internal circuitry ensures efficient regulation while minimizing power consumption.

Q: What is the TC1300Y-2.7VUATR? A: The TC1300Y-2.7VUATR is a voltage regulator IC (integrated circuit) that provides a stable output voltage of 2.7V.
Q: What are the typical applications of TC1300Y-2.7VUATR? A: The TC1300Y-2.7VUATR is commonly used in battery-powered devices, portable electronics, and low-power microcontroller systems.
Q: What is the input voltage range for TC1300Y-2.7VUATR? A: The input voltage range for TC1300Y-2.7VUATR is typically between 2.5V and 6.0V.
Q: What is the maximum output current of TC1300Y-2.7VUATR? A: The maximum output current of TC1300Y-2.7VUATR is 300mA.
Q: Does TC1300Y-2.7VUATR require any external components for operation? A: Yes, TC1300Y-2.7VUATR requires a minimum of two external capacitors for stability and proper operation.
Q: Can TC1300Y-2.7VUATR handle input voltage fluctuations? A: Yes, TC1300Y-2.7VUATR has built-in protection features to handle input voltage fluctuations and provide a stable output voltage.
Q: Is TC1300Y-2.7VUATR suitable for low-power applications? A: Yes, TC1300Y-2.7VUATR is designed for low-power applications and has a low quiescent current of typically 30µA.
Q: Can TC1300Y-2.7VUATR operate in harsh environments? A: TC1300Y-2.7VUATR has a wide operating temperature range of -40°C to +125°C, making it suitable for various environmental conditions.
Q: Does TC1300Y-2.7VUATR have any built-in protection features? A: Yes, TC1300Y-2.7VUATR includes overcurrent protection, thermal shutdown, and reverse battery protection to ensure safe operation.
Q: Is there a recommended PCB layout for TC1300Y-2.7VUATR? A: Yes, the datasheet of TC1300Y-2.7VUATR provides a recommended PCB layout to optimize performance and minimize noise.
